Transaction 6ebdcc4d69226dc9428b75f9725f78c1966d4b8a652a9c7eac0ef148fe3cd72d
1 Input
1 Output
-
6ebdcc4d69226dc9428b75f9725f78c1966d4b8a652a9c7eac0ef148fe3cd72d:0
- value
- 80313465
- script pubkey
- OP_0 OP_PUSHBYTES_20 bea73673b86e9f7d341b21cc673601ff4cda89ca
- address
- bc1qh6nnvuacd60h6dqmy8xxwdsplaxd4zw2k2qxce